OPTIMASI NANONISASI JAHE MERAH DAN KAYU SECANG MELALU PLANETARY BALL MILL: KARAKTERISASI AWAL UNTUK FORMULASI MINUMAN NANO-HERBAL IMUNOMODULATOR

Jahe merah (Zingiber officinale var. rubrum) dan kayu secang (Caesalpinia sappan) merupakan tanaman herbal kaya senyawa bioaktif berpotensi untuk kesehatan dan pangan fungsional. Nanonisasi meningkatkan efektivitas senyawa bioaktif dengan memperkecil ukuran partikel, sehingga memperluas luas permukaan dan meningkatkan bioavailabilitas.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engoptimasi proses nanonisasi jahe merah dan kayu secang dengan variasi waktu milling serta mengevaluasi pengaruhnya terhadap ukuran partikel dan keseragaman distribusi ukuran partikel. Serbuk jahe merah dan kayu secang diproses menggunakan Planetary Ball Mill selama 2, 4, 6, 10, dan 12 jam. Karakterisasi ukuran partikel dilakukan menggunakan Zetasizer Pro dengan parameter yang diamati meliputi ukuran rata-rata partikel (Z-Average), indeks polidispersitas (PI), distribusi ukuran partikel (D10, D50, D90), serta persentase partikel dalam rentang ukuran yang diinginkan (In Range (%)). Hasil menunjukkan bahwa peningkatan durasi milling menyebabkan penurunan ukuran partikel dan peningkatan keseragaman distribusi partikel. Ukuran rata-rata partikel jahe merah menurun dari 1054 nm (2 jam) menjadi 498,9 nm (12 jam), dengan indeks polidispersitas yang menurun dari 0,7194 menjadi 0,5025. Serbuk kayu secang mengalami fluktuasi ukuran pada durasi awal milling, tetapi menunjukkan penurunan ukuran hingga mencapai 204,6 nm pada 12 jam, dengan indeks polidispersitas yang menurun dari 1,0000 menjadi 0,4254. Kesimpulan dari penelitian ini yaitu durasi milling yang lebih lama menghasilkan partikel yang lebih kecil dan lebih seragam; durasi 12 jam merupakan kondisi optimum pada penelitian ini. Temuan ini menjadi dasar awal untuk tahap formulasi minuman nano-herbal berbasis jahe dan kayu secang.
